ARB
Classes | Macros | Enumerations | Functions
SaiProbeVisualization.hxx File Reference
#include <cctype>
#include <vector>
#include <awt_canvas.hxx>
#include <string>
Include dependency graph for SaiProbeVisualization.hxx:
This graph shows which files directly or indirectly include this file:

Go to the source code of this file.

Classes

class  saiProbeData
 
struct  SAI_graphic
 

Macros

#define sai_assert(cond)   arb_assert(cond)
 
#define AWAR_SPV_SAI_2_PROBE   "sai_visualize/sai_2_probe"
 
#define AWAR_SPV_DISP_SAI   "sai_visualize/disp_sai"
 
#define AWAR_SPV_SAI_COLOR   "sai_visualize/probeSai/color_0"
 
#define AWAR_SPV_DB_FIELD_NAME   "sai_visualize/db_field_name"
 
#define AWAR_SPV_DB_FIELD_WIDTH   "sai_visualize/db_field_width"
 
#define AWAR_SPV_ACI_COMMAND   "sai_visualize/aci_command"
 
#define AWAR_SPV_SELECTED_PROBE   "sai_visualize/selected_probe"
 
#define SAI_CLR_COUNT   10
 

Enumerations

enum  { PROBE, PROBE_PREFIX, PROBE_SUFFIX }
 
enum  {
  SAI_GC_HIGHLIGHT, SAI_GC_HIGHLIGHT_FONT = SAI_GC_HIGHLIGHT, SAI_GC_FOREGROUND, SAI_GC_FOREGROUND_FONT = SAI_GC_FOREGROUND,
  SAI_GC_PROBE, SAI_GC_PROBE_FONT = SAI_GC_PROBE, SAI_GC_0, SAI_GC_1,
  SAI_GC_2, SAI_GC_3, SAI_GC_4, SAI_GC_5,
  SAI_GC_6, SAI_GC_7, SAI_GC_8, SAI_GC_9,
  SAI_GC_MAX
}
 

Functions

AW_windowcreateSaiProbeMatchWindow (AW_root *awr, GBDATA *gb_main)
 
void transferProbeData (saiProbeData *spd)
 

Macro Definition Documentation

#define sai_assert (   cond)    arb_assert(cond)
#define AWAR_SPV_SAI_2_PROBE   "sai_visualize/sai_2_probe"
#define AWAR_SPV_DISP_SAI   "sai_visualize/disp_sai"
#define AWAR_SPV_SAI_COLOR   "sai_visualize/probeSai/color_0"

Definition at line 20 of file SaiProbeVisualization.hxx.

Referenced by getAwarName().

#define AWAR_SPV_DB_FIELD_NAME   "sai_visualize/db_field_name"
#define AWAR_SPV_DB_FIELD_WIDTH   "sai_visualize/db_field_width"
#define AWAR_SPV_ACI_COMMAND   "sai_visualize/aci_command"
#define AWAR_SPV_SELECTED_PROBE   "sai_visualize/selected_probe"
#define SAI_CLR_COUNT   10

Enumeration Type Documentation

anonymous enum
Enumerator
PROBE 
PROBE_PREFIX 
PROBE_SUFFIX 

Definition at line 29 of file SaiProbeVisualization.hxx.

anonymous enum
Enumerator
SAI_GC_HIGHLIGHT 
SAI_GC_HIGHLIGHT_FONT 
SAI_GC_FOREGROUND 
SAI_GC_FOREGROUND_FONT 
SAI_GC_PROBE 
SAI_GC_PROBE_FONT 
SAI_GC_0 
SAI_GC_1 
SAI_GC_2 
SAI_GC_3 
SAI_GC_4 
SAI_GC_5 
SAI_GC_6 
SAI_GC_7 
SAI_GC_8 
SAI_GC_9 
SAI_GC_MAX 

Definition at line 35 of file SaiProbeVisualization.hxx.

Function Documentation

AW_window* createSaiProbeMatchWindow ( AW_root awr,
GBDATA gb_main 
)
void transferProbeData ( saiProbeData spd)

Definition at line 622 of file SaiProbeVisualization.cxx.

Referenced by popupSaiProbeMatchWindow(), and probe_match_event().